Olivia Workshop On The Go - with a twist on the color

This is a card inspired by my good friend Kelly Waterman who made a layout many years ago using fall leaves and these spring colors. It was so pretty and stuck in my head - so when I say the Olivia WOTG stamp set I knew I had to make a card using those same colors, Amethyst, Heavenly Blue, Key Lime and Baby Pink.  It makes a fun spring themed card. I used the piercing tool to make the stitching holes along the left hand side of the ink distressed Amethyst cardstock and used the corner rounder with the guide removed to make the scalloped edge and then used a hole punch in those scallops. The word Delight was stamped in Cocoa ink.

Canvas mini album

Here is a mini album which was partly made from a kit from Quick Quotes, It included the ribbons and embellishments but then I swapped out the cardstock and paper for Close To My Heart items :O)
This is the back of the album and shows Me, Dana and LisaMarie. I used the stamp set which we were given for attending Convention and it features the logos used throughout Convention.
I used some of the new Olivia paper to decorate the pages of the album. I love the way it turned out. I dry embossed and then sanded the panel at the bottom of the 4th page.
